3. Health Risks Associated with Contaminated Ramen Noodles

Health risks associated with consuming contaminated ramen noodles can vary depending on the type of contamination. Some of the potential health issues include:

  • Foodborne illnesses caused by bacteria such as Salmonella or E. coli.
  • Allergic reactions for individuals sensitive to undeclared allergens.
  • Gastrointestinal distress, including n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ea.

Due to the serious health implications, it is crucial for consumers to take the recall seriously and ensure that they are not consuming any affected products.
